Almost ruptured the esophagus after swallowing a pill with the film still in it

Hà Vi |

Hung Yen - A woman had to be hospitalized after mistakenly taking a pill with a blister pack intact, causing a foreign object to be stuck in her esophagus.

On August 5, according to Hung Yen Provincial General Hospital, the Department of Functional Detection just received a female patient for examination in a state of chest pain, difficulty swallowing and a feeling of stuck swallowing, painful swallowing after taking medicine.

Through examination and esophago-gastric endoscopy, doctors discovered a pill still intact in a film blister stuck in the esophagus. The sharp edges of the film blister were stuck in the esophagus lining, posing a risk of abrasions, bleeding, ulcers, and even perforation of the esophagus if not treated promptly.

Immediately after that, the functional exploration department team performed interventional endoscopy and successfully removed the foreign object, ensuring safety and minimizing damage to the patient. After the procedure, the patient stabilized, and symptoms of chest tightness and difficulty swallowing were clearly improved.

Doctors recommend that people carefully check the medicine before taking it, make sure the medicine has been completely removed from the blister, drink it with enough water and in the correct position. At the same time, do not take the medicine in a hurry or loss of concentration. If after drinking, signs such as neck pain, chest pain, swallowing pain, difficulty swallowing or feeling of foreign objects appear, it is necessary to go to a medical facility immediately for examination and timely treatment.
